The Historical Roots of Patang Flying
The origins of kite flying are deeply rooted in ancient China, dating back over 2,500 years. Initially crafted from materials like silk and bamboo, kites were not primarily used for recreation but served military purposes â signaling, measuring distances, and even testing wind conditions. Over time, these practical tools transitioned into symbols of celebration and artistry, spreading across Asia through trade and cultural exchange. The art of patang, as we know it today, particularly flourished in India, evolving into a unique form of competitive sport, inseparable from cultural festivals and celebrations.
The Indian Adaptation and Competitive Evolution
Upon arriving in India, kite flying rapidly integrated itself into the social and cultural landscape. Local artisans began experimenting with different materials and designs, resulting in kites that were optimized for the unique wind patterns and competitive styles prevalent in the region. This led to the development of specific techniques, such as âmanjaâ â the coating of kite strings with a mixture of crushed glass â designed to sever the strings of opposing kites, awarding victory to the one that remains airborne.
The use of manja transformed patang from a leisurely pastime into a fierce competition, demanding skill, agility, and a careful understanding of your opponentâs strategy. Annual festivals like Makar Sankranti witness massive gatherings of kite enthusiasts, vying for dominance in the sky, making it a vibrant display of tradition and excitement. The competitive spirit drives innovation in kite design and string preparation, constantly raising the stakes.

The Art and Science of Kite Design
Creating a high-performing kite isn’t merely about aesthetics; itâs a careful application of aerodynamic principles. The shape, size, weight distribution, and materials all play critical roles in determining a kiteâs stability, lift, and maneuverability. Traditionally, kites were built using natural materials â bamboo for the frame and silk or paper for the sail. However, modern innovations have introduced synthetic materials like ripstop nylon and carbon fiber, offering improved strength, durability, and wind resistance.
A well-designed patang needs to balance these elements to remain aloft and responsive to the flyerâs commands. The bridle â the point where the flying line connects to the kite â is crucial in adjusting the angle of attack and controlling the kiteâs direction. Skilled kite makers meticulously fine-tune these parameters, considering the intended flying environment and the desired performance characteristics. The complexity of achieving optimal flight highlights the intersection of artistry and scientific knowledge.
- Frame Construction: Bambooâs flexibility and strength provide a light yet robust structure.
- Sail Material: Ripstop nylon offers a superior strength-to-weight ratio compared to traditional paper or silk.
- Bridle Adjustment: Precise bridle adjustments are essential for controlling the kiteâs pitch and yaw.
- String Selection: Choosing the right string â be it cotton, synthetic, or coated with manja â is vital for strength and cutting ability.
Understanding these basic principles helps in appreciating the detailed work put into building a well-made kite. The goal is to create a device able to withstand high winds and aerial battles.
Mastering Kite Flying Techniques
While flying a kite may seem intuitive, mastering the art requires practice, patience, and a nuanced understanding of wind dynamics. Launching a kite involves finding a clear, open space, facing into the wind, and slowly releasing the line while maintaining tension. The key is to allow the wind to fill the sail and lift the kite into the air. However, maintaining control requires continuous adjustments to the line, responding to fluctuations in wind speed and direction.
Advanced techniques, such as side-winding and pivoting, allow experienced flyers to execute complex maneuvers and defend against opponents. âSide-windingâ involves quickly reeling in and releasing the line, creating a zig-zagging motion that can disorient the opponent, whereas pivoting the kites involves quick adjustments that allows for cutting of opposing patang strings. These skills are honed through countless hours of practice and a keen awareness of the windâs behavior. The beauty of patang is its blend of skill and anticipation.
- Wind Assessment: Before launching, carefully assess wind speed and direction.
- Line Control: Maintain consistent tension on the line to prevent the kite from falling.
- Bridle Adjustment: Fine-tune the bridle for optimal stability and responsiveness.
- Opponent Observation: Anticipate your opponentâs moves and react accordingly.
Successful mastery takes much skill but greatly enhances the thrill of the game.
Patang in Modern Culture and Celebrations
Today, patang remains a vibrant part of cultural traditions across many countries, most notably in India and Afghanistan. Festivals like Makar Sankranti, Basant Panchami, and kite flying competitions attract large crowds, creating a festive atmosphere filled with music, food, and the constant whirring of kites in the sky. While the competitive element remains strong, kite flying also serves as a social activity, bringing families and communities together.
Furthermore, there’s a growing resurgence of interest in kite making and flying as a creative outlet. Artisans are experimenting with new designs, materials, and techniques, resulting in breathtakingly beautiful and innovative kites. This modern revival showcases the enduring appeal of patang as both a cultural tradition and a form of artistic expression.
